This pencil sketch, “Frau mit Leier spielendem Putto”, by German artist Victor Müller depicts a woman and a putto, a winged cherub-like figure. The woman is positioned centrally in the composition, with her back to the viewer, as she holds a lyre. She is accompanied by a putto who is looking at her with a mischievous expression. The figures are drawn with a delicate touch, suggesting a sense of grace and intimacy. The background is left mostly empty, drawing focus to the figures in the foreground. This piece, housed in the Städel Museum, is a preparatory study for a larger work, highlighting Müller’s skill in capturing the human form.
